Alec J Marsh
Trans man Will dreads going home for the holidays, where his feminist Wiccan family smothers him with clumsy, sometimes harmful support. While stuck in their tiny town for the Solstice, he reconnects with Bea, a woman he went to high school with. Will got out, but she never quite managed it. Over the week, they find comfort in each other, and insulation from the pain of small town life.
Rated: M for an explicit sex scene
Length: 24,000 words
CWs: clumsy family support, circuitous misgendering, a lot of gender feelings, narcissistic parents.
